Gettick: Gettick is a customer support and help desk software designed for small businesses. It allows companies to manage customer queries and requests efficiently through multiple support channels like email, live chat, social media and more.

Gogs: Gogs is a self-hosted Git service written in Go. It is lightweight, easy to install and uses lower system resources than GitHub. Gogs supports features like issue tracking, pull requests and web hooks.

Gogs
Gogs Features
  • Git repository hosting
  • Web-based Git access
  • User and organization accounts
  • Access control for repositories
  • Activity timeline
  • Issue tracking
  • Pull requests
  • Wikis
  • Webhooks

Gogs
Gogs

Pros

  • Easy installation
  • Lightweight resource usage
  • Self-hosted and private option
  • Open source and free
  • Good for small teams

Cons

  • Limited integrations compared to GitHub
  • Less features than GitHub
  • Not ideal for large enterprises
  • Setup and admin requires technical skills
